Like you, we too are faced with heightened corporate loot of all our
resources, growing imperialist intervention in our internal affairs,
repressive state policies and divisive communal forces relentlessly
threatening to disrupt the unity of the people and divert the people’s
attention along sectarian lines. More than six decades since the
partition of India and Pakistan, chauvinism still remains an important
weapon in the hands of the rulers on both sides of the border and the
prospects of peace and cooperation between the two countries are
constantly undermined by constant deliberate whipping up of bilateral
tension and frenzied war cries at regular intervals. US imperialism
which has a vested interest in fuelling tension between India and
Pakistan and promoting an ever escalating arms race is working overtime
to intervene in the region and pit India and Pakistan against each
other.
It
is imperative for the Left in both India and Pakistan to resist this
imperialist design and work consistently for bilateral peace,
cooperation and friendship. The CPI(ML) and LPP have a history of shared
initiatives and mutual exchanges towards this common goal and we are
sure in the coming days we will be able to further strengthen our
comradely ties and defeat the designs of our pro-imperialist rulers.

Revolutionary parties always struggle against seemingly overwhelming
odds for the liberation of humanity. Today your deliberations take
place at a time when the global capitalist system threatens the very
survival of the human species.
Of all human institutions, the one least able to save our environment
is the capitalist state, because it has been created and structured to
defend the very forces that are responsible for environmental
destruction. It is up to working people, who gain nothing and stand to
lose everything from environmental destruction, to create the necessary
consciousness and the organisations that can stop the capitalists. To
save our planet and therefore ourselves, working people will need to
create their own state, a revolutionary state that destroys the
political power and then the economic power of the capitalists. As was
said by Hugo Chavez, the president of Venezuela, in a speech at the
recent Copenhagen summit: /“Socialism, this is the direction, this is
the path to save the planet, I don’t have the least doubt. Capitalism
is the road to hell, to the destruction of the world.”/
US imperialism’s continuous war in the Middle East and Asia ,
essentially a war to ensure their control of the dwindling oil supply,
is costing a fortune, having a big impact on the US economy, creating
millions of angry enemies of imperialism, and impacting on the American
poor and working class who have to fight these wars. Palestine, Iraq,
Afghanistan, Yemen, Iran, and the list expands, and no peace, just
further exposure of US imperialism and its allies in Europe, Australia
etc.
But
a powerful challenge to capitalism is occurring in Latin America. Cuba
has stood fast for 51 years, and now the Venezuelan Revolution has
opened a new front in working class resistance.
The RSP, like the LPP, has welcomed Chavez’ call for a new Fifth
Socialist International. This call signifies a new offensive for
collaboration among revolutionary socialists around the world, but
particularly in Latin America, which today is the epicentre of the
worldwide struggle for socialism. The Chavez leadership clearly
recognizes that the best defence of revolutionary Venezuela will be
further socialist revolutions in other countries.
Your party is coming out of a long struggle against the imperialist
military dictatorship in which the LPP played a principled and leading
role from the day General Musharaf seized power. Despite the defeat of
the Musharaf regime as a result of the mass movement against it, the
working-class and peasant poor of Pakistan still suffer from the legacy
of the Musharaf years, including escalation of imperialist military
intervention into Pakistan as well as from the right-wing agenda of
religious fundamentalists. The RSP shares your mourning for the loss of
your comrades Abdullah Qureshi in 2007 and Master Khudad Khan in 2009 to
fundamentalist suicide bombings.
